drm/vmwgfx: Move screen object page flip to atomic function
authorDeepak Rawat <drawat@vmware.com>
Tue, 16 Jan 2018 07:31:04 +0000 (08:31 +0100)
committerThomas Hellstrom <thellstrom@vmware.com>
Thu, 22 Mar 2018 09:57:04 +0000 (10:57 +0100)
commitaa64b3f18aeb2cc4b74e69115df434147f1ed96c
tree0972977d464761bb1513bd5566a4e6bd7fc7ec93
parent3cbe87fcf026e4cdae6719511267ef020256bf5c
drm/vmwgfx: Move screen object page flip to atomic function

The dmabuf_dirty/surface_dirty in case of screen object is moved to
plane atomic update, so that page flip in atomic ioctl also works.

vmwgfx does not support DRM_MODE_PAGE_FLIP_ASYNC, so this flag is never
expected.

Signed-off-by: Deepak Rawat <drawat@vmware.com>
Reviewed-by: Sinclair Yeh <syeh@vmware.com>
Signed-off-by: Thomas Hellstrom <thellstrom@vmware.com>
drivers/gpu/drm/vmwgfx/vmwgfx_scrn.c